| Compound | Amount | Unit | Conc. [g/L] | Conc. [mM] | |
|---|---|---|---|---|---|
| KH2PO4 | 0.30 | g | 0.298 | 2.187 | |
| NaCl | 0.60 | g | 0.595 | 10.186 | |
| MgCl2 x 6 H2O | 0.10 | g | 0.099 | 0.488 | |
| CaCl2 x 2 H2O | 0.08 | g | 0.079 | 0.54 | |
| NH4Cl | 1.00 | g | 0.992 | 18.547 | |
| Trace element solution SL-11 | 1.00 | ml | - | - | |
| Selenite-tungstate solution | 1.00 | ml | - | - | |
|
Sodium resazurin
(0.1% w/v) |
0.50 | ml | 5.0e-4 | 0.002 | |
| KHCO3 | 3.50 | g | 3.472 | 34.682 | |
| L-Cysteine HCl x H2O | 0.60 | g | 0.595 | 3.389 | |
|
Methanol
(50% v/v) |
6.00 | ml | 4.714 | 147.128 | |
| Wolin's vitamin solution (10x) | 1.00 | ml | - | - | |
| Na2S x 9 H2O | 0.30 | g | 0.298 | 1.239 | |
| Distilled water | 1000.00 | ml | - | - | |
| 1 Dissolve ingredients (except bicarbonate, cysteine, methanol, vitamins and sulfide), sparge medium with 80% N2 and 20% CO2 gas mixture for 30 - 45 min to make it anoxic, then add solid bicarbonate and cysteine and equilibrate the medium with the gas mixture to reach a pH of 7.0. Dispense medium under 80% N2 and 20% CO2 gas atmosphere into anoxic Hungate-type tubes or serum vials and autoclave. To the autoclaved medium add methanol (50% v/v solution), vitamins and sulfide from sterile anoxic stock solutions prepared under 100% N2 gas. Vitamins should be sterilized by filtration. Adjust pH of complete medium to 7.0 - 7.2, if necessary. | |||||
| Compound | Amount | Unit | Conc. [g/L] | Conc. [mM] | |
|---|---|---|---|---|---|
| Na2-EDTA x 2 H2O | 5.2 | g | 5.2 | 15.467 | |
| FeCl2 x 4 H2O | 1.5 | g | 1.5 | 7.545 | |
| ZnCl2 | 70.0 | mg | 0.07 | 0.514 | |
| MnCl2 x 4 H2O | 100.0 | mg | 0.1 | 0.505 | |
| H3BO3 | 6.0 | mg | 0.006 | 0.097 | |
| CoCl2 x 6 H2O | 190.0 | mg | 0.19 | 1.463 | |
| CuCl2 x 2 H2O | 2.0 | mg | 0.002 | 0.012 | |
| NiCl2 x 6 H2O | 24.0 | mg | 0.024 | 0.185 | |
| Na2MoO4 x 2 H2O | 36.0 | mg | 0.036 | 0.149 | |
| Distilled water | 1000.0 | ml | - | - | |
| 1 Dissolve EDTA in 800 ml distilled water, adjust pH to 7 using 2 N NaOH and add ferrous chloride. After ferrous chloride has dissolved add other compounds. Finally adjust pH to 6.0 and bring volume to 1000 ml. | |||||
